What Is the Cost of Living Near San Diego?

Understanding the cost of living near San Diego is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Biostatresearch.com.
San Diego's Cost of Living Index is approximately 160.4 (60.4% more expensive than US average; 14.7% more than CA average). Very high housing costs are the primary driver, along with generally higher prices for other goods and services. When planning your budget based on a salary from Biostatresearch.com,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,200 - $3,400+ A significant portion of Biostatresearch.com sal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$72 (MTS mon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$460 - $680 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$850+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,722 - $5,922+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
